1. New Perpetual Market Listing

Overview: On July 7, Orderly Network added SYN to its perpetual futures markets with up to 10x leverage (OrderlyNetwork). This listing increases SYN's accessibility for speculative and hedging activity, directly expanding its utility beyond its core cross-chain bridge function.

What it means: The move is a utility-driven catalyst, attracting new capital and trading interest to a token with a relatively modest ~$96M market cap.

Watch for: Whether open interest builds on these new markets, indicating sustained derivatives demand.

2. Social Sentiment & Volume Confirmation

Overview: A trader publicly noted accumulating SYN around a ~$100M market cap for its "asymmetric upside" on July 7 (askthedr). This coincided with a 100.43% surge in 24h spot volume to $65.86M, confirming strong buyer interest.

What it means: Social calls can amplify retail interest, while the volume spike validates the price move as more than just a low-liquidity pump.
